jquery 获取input checkbox checked属性
如果使用jquery,应使用prop方法来获取和设置checked属性
1.通过prop方法获取checked属性,获取的checked返回值为boolean,选中为true,否则为flase
1
2
3
4
5
6
7
|
<input type= "checkbox" id= "selectAll" onclick= "checkAll()" >全选
function checkAll()
{
var checkedOfAll=$( "#selectAll" ).prop( "checked" );
alert(checkedOfAll);
$( "input[name='procheck']" ).prop( "checked" , checkedOfAll);
}
|
2.如果使用attr方法获取时,如果当前input中初始化未定义checked属性,则不管当前是否选中,$("#selectAll").attr("checked")都会返回undefined;
1
|
<input type= "checkbox" id= "selectAll" onclick= "checkAll()" >全选
|
3.如果当前input中初始化已定义checked属性,则不管是否选中,$("#selectAll").attr("checked")都会返回checked.
1
2
3
4
5
6
7
|
<input type= "checkbox" id= "selectAll" onclick= "checkAll()" checked >全选
function checkAll()
{
var checkedOfAll=$( "#selectAll" ).attr( "checked" );
alert(checkedOfAll);
$( "input[name='procheck']" ).attr( "checked" , checkedOfAll);
}
|
总结,如果使用jquery,应使用prop方法来获取和设置checked属性,不应使用attr.
jquery 获取input checkbox checked属性相关推荐
- jquery attr方法获取input的checked属性问题
1.通过prop方法获取checked属性,获取的checked返回值为boolean,选中为true,否则为flase <input type="checkbox" id= ...
- 如何通过js获取html文本框中的值,js与jquery获取input输入框中的值实例讲解
如何用javascript获取input输入框中的值,js/jq通过name.id.class获取input输入框中的value 先准备一段 HTML 一.jquery获取input文本框中的值 通过 ...
- html取 输入框中的值,jquery获取input输入框中的值
如何用javascript获取input输入框中的值,js/jq通过name.id.class获取input输入框中的value 先准备一段 HTML 一.jquery获取input文本框中的值 通过 ...
- jQuery获取、设置标签属性值
jQuery获取.设置标签属性值 jQuery提供了两种方法: attr():传入一个参数获取某属性值,两个参数:修改某属性值,返回参数的值(不推荐操作checked.readOnly.selecte ...
- js原生、jquery获取input为text的输入框(单个/多个) 并清空value(bootstrap 输入框)
一.用bootstrap框架写了一个简单的表单,html结构和效果图如下: <form> <div class="form-row mb-2"><d ...
- JQuery获取元素的display属性
JQuery获取元素的display属性 $('#input_id').css('display')
- checkbox checked属性值
记住我1<input type='checkbox' />记住我2<input type='checkbox' /><button onclick='hehe();' t ...
- [转]使用jQuery获取radio/checkbox组的值的代码收集
今天来看下JQ对天Checkbox复选框的操作.看下面的一个小例子.在这个例子中包括了以下几个功能 代码如下: <!-- $("document").ready(functi ...
- jquery 获取Input 值
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- jquery获取input值
今天一直很纠结,用jquery获取inout输入的值,一直都是undifined,因为好久没用了,就查api ,查资料,纠结了好久才找出原因. 贴下我的错误代码 function checkUserN ...
最新文章
- Squid代理服务器基本配置(三)
- 禁用java rmi_java-如何安全关闭rmi客户端?
- linux搭建宝塔重启mysql_宝塔面板安装 重启等命令linux系统重启
- C++学习基础八——重载输入和输出操作符
- 前端学习(1550):$scope和调试工具
- HTML期末作业-中国足球网页
- php 随机数 名称,php – 从标题更改为随机数
- 这组三八妇女节海报素材psd模板,你给打几分?
- JMeter使用jar进行压力测试
- 笔记-method-swizzling~那些年,一起遇过的坑
- map分组后取前10个_35岁詹皇有多强?17年生涯首拿助攻王背后:10个月前早已定下目标...
- Android平台下渗透测试工具大集合
- 马克思主义基本原理概论
- Java过滤微信昵称特殊字符
- Widget Extention开发笔记
- IONIC中slides的使用(图片显示及其删除)
- 《Android进阶指北》进阶必备,今日送出8本
- ffmpeg压缩命令
- Android简单电子书
- PySpark线性回归与广义线性模型